About Dependent Visa Law in Cluj-Napoca, Romania

Dependent Visa in Cluj-Napoca, Romania is a legal document that allows individuals to join their family members who are living and working in Romania. This visa category is specifically designed for dependents, including spouses, children, and parents, who wish to join their loved ones and reside in Cluj-Napoca.

Local Laws Overview

Understanding the key aspects of local laws related to Dependent Visa in Cluj-Napoca, Romania is crucial. Here's a summary of some important information you should be aware of:

1. Sponsorship Requirement:

To be eligible for a Dependent Visa, you must have a family member who is a Romanian citizen or a foreigner legally residing in Romania as the sponsor.

2. Financial Support:

The sponsor must demonstrate the ability to financially support the dependents throughout their stay in Romania. This typically involves showing proof of income, employment, or other financial resources.

3. Documentation:

Applicants must provide various supporting documents like passports, marriage certificates, birth certificates, and other official records to prove their relationship to the sponsor.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What is the processing time for a Dependent Visa application in Cluj-Napoca, Romania?

The processing time for a Dependent Visa application can vary, but it usually takes around 30 to 60 days. Delays may occur due to individual case circumstances or if additional documentation is requested.

Q: Can I work in Cluj-Napoca on a Dependent Visa?

No, a Dependent Visa does not grant you automatic permission to work in Cluj-Napoca, Romania. If you wish to work, you will need to obtain a separate work permit or explore other appropriate options.

Q: Can I study in Cluj-Napoca on a Dependent Visa?

Dependent Visa holders are allowed to pursue education in Cluj-Napoca; however, it is essential to check specific requirements and restrictions imposed by educational institutions and relevant authorities.

Q: Can I extend my Dependent Visa in Cluj-Napoca?

Yes, it is possible to extend your Dependent Visa in Cluj-Napoca, Romania. However, you must initiate the extension process before your current visa expires and fulfill all the necessary requirements for extension.

Q: What happens if my Dependent Visa application is denied?

If your Dependent Visa application is denied, you may have the option to appeal the decision or reapply. Consulting with a lawyer can help you understand the reasons for denial and explore the best course of action.
